What is Shipping Container Architecture?
Shipping container architecture involves making use of repurposed shipping containers as the main structure product for building numerous structures. These steel containers are developed to stand up to the extreme conditions of sea travel, making them resilient, strong, and sustainable choices for construction. By repurposing containers, designers and builders can produce innovative styles while lessening waste and promoting ecological sustainability.

One of the most engaging arguments for shipping container architecture is its sustainability. By repurposing existing materials, contractors can considerably lower the ecological impact generally associated with new construction. This lines up with the growing need for eco-friendly structure practices.
Cost-Effectiveness
Shipping containers are typically more inexpensive than standard structure products. This cost-effectiveness is particularly appealing for start-ups, small companies, and individuals seeking to develop on a spending plan.
Toughness
Developed to sustain the rigors of maritime transport, shipping containers are incredibly strong and resistant to different ecological conditions. This durability makes them ideal for varied climates and areas.
Modularity
The modular nature of shipping containers enables imaginative and flexible designs. Designers can quickly stack and organize containers to create distinct designs customized to particular requirements.
Quick Assembly
Construction utilizing shipping containers can typically be finished in a portion of the time needed for standard building approaches. This fast assembly can use considerable cost savings on labor expenses.
Movement
One of the significant benefits of container architecture is its fundamental movement. Structures can be transferred and moved with relative ease, making them suitable for temporary or mobile applications.
Applications of Shipping Container Architecture
Shipping containers can be used in a variety of applications, consisting of but not limited to:
1. Residential Homes
Lots of architects and homeowners are checking out shipping containers as a viable alternative for budget-friendly housing. The modular design permits unique modification, while the sustainability aspect attract environmentally conscious buyers.
2. Commercial Spaces
From pop-up shops to long-term retail outlets, shipping containers can be transformed into appealing business spaces. Their mobility enables organizations to relocate based upon need or seasonal patterns.
3. Workplaces
As remote work becomes more common, container offices have acquired popularity. They provide an economical option for small companies or freelance professionals looking for individualized work space.
4. Community Projects
Shipping containers have been effectively used in neighborhood jobs, such as schools, health care centers, and community centers. These structures can be rapidly deployed to resolve urgent needs in underserved areas.
5. Art Installations
Artists and designers are progressively using shipping containers for imaginative setups and exhibitions. Their distinct shapes can work as a canvas for innovative design.
